iis服务器助手广告广告
返回顶部
首页 > 资讯 > 精选 >如何使用netcat进行文件传输
  • 433
分享到

如何使用netcat进行文件传输

2023-06-09 17:06:45 433人浏览 薄情痞子
摘要

这篇文章将为大家详细讲解有关如何使用netcat进行文件传输,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。首先看一下帮助信息。$ nc -hOpenBSD netcat&nb

这篇文章将为大家详细讲解有关如何使用netcat进行文件传输,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。

首先看一下帮助信息。

$ nc -hOpenBSD netcat (Debian patchlevel 1.105-7ubuntu1)This is nc from the netcat-openbsd package. An alternative nc is availablein the netcat-traditional package.usage: nc [-46bCDdhjklnrStUuvZz] [-I length] [-i interval] [-O length]   [-P proxy_username] [-p source_port] [-q seconds] [-s source]   [-T toskeyWord] [-V rtable] [-w timeout] [-X proxy_protocol]   [-x proxy_address[:port]] [destination] [port]  Command Summary:    -4    Use IPv4    -6    Use IPv6    -b    Allow broadcast    -C    Send CRLF as line-ending    -D    Enable the debug Socket option    -d    Detach from stdin    -h    This help text    -I length  tcp receive buffer length    -i secs    Delay interval for lines sent, ports scanned    -j    Use jumbo frame    -k    Keep inbound sockets open for multiple connects    -l    Listen mode, for inbound connects    -n    Suppress name/port resolutions    -O length  TCP send buffer length    -P proxyuser  Username for proxy authentication    -p port    Specify local port for remote connects      -q secs    quit after EOF on stdin and delay of secs    -r    Randomize remote ports    -S    Enable the TCP MD5 signature option    -s addr    Local source address    -T toskeyword  Set IP Type of Service    -t    Answer TELNET neGotiation    -U    Use UNIX domain socket    -u    UDP mode    -V rtable  Specify alternate routing table    -v    Verbose    -w secs    Timeout for connects and final net reads    -X proto  Proxy protocol: "4", "5" (SOCKS) or "connect"    -x addr[:port]  Specify proxy address and port    -Z    DCCP mode    -z    Zero-I/O mode [used for scanning]  Port numbers can be individual or ranges: lo-hi [inclusive]

端口扫描:

$ nc -z -v -n 127.0.0.1 20-100...Connection to 127.0.0.1 80 port [tcp/*] succeeded!...

简单文件传输:

客户端:

$ nc -l 192.168.1.11 1234 > passwd.txt &

服务端:

$ nc 192.168.1.11 1234 < /etc/passwd

也可以是

cat /etc/passwd | nc 192.168.1.11 1234

服务端ip是192.169.1.11,端口是1234

如此,当两台linux机器需要简单传输文件时,再好不过了~

关于“如何使用netcat进行文件传输”这篇文章就分享到这里了,希望以上内容可以对大家有一定的帮助,使各位可以学到更多知识,如果觉得文章不错,请把它分享出去让更多的人看到。

--结束END--

本文标题: 如何使用netcat进行文件传输

本文链接: https://www.lsjlt.com/news/257003.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• 如何使用netcat进行文件传输
    这篇文章将为大家详细讲解有关如何使用netcat进行文件传输,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。首先看一下帮助信息。$ nc -hOpenBSD netcat&nb...
    99+
    2023-06-09
  • 使用netcat(瑞士军刀)进行文件传输
    nc(netcat)被誉为网络工具中的“瑞士军刀”,体积虽小但功能强大,nc最简单的功能是端口扫描,这里我主要笔记一下它作为文件传输的妙用。 首先看一下帮助信息。 $ nc -h OpenBSD ne...
    99+
    2022-06-04
    文件传输 瑞士军刀 netcat
  • 详解Python如何使用Netmiko进行文件传输
    目录Netmiko简介Netmiko安装使用Netmiko的SCP函数传输文件从设备传输文件到本地计算机从本地计算机传输文件到设备总结在网络设备管理中,传输配置文件、镜像文件等是经常...
    99+
    2023-05-18
    Python Netmiko实现文件传输 Python Netmiko文件传输 Python Netmiko
  • 如何在golang中使用WebSocket进行文件传输
    如何在golang中使用WebSocket进行文件传输WebSocket是一种支持双向通信的网络协议,能够在浏览器和服务器之间建立持久的连接。在golang中,我们可以使用第三方库gorilla/websocket来实现WebSocket功...
    99+
    2023-12-18
    Golang websocket 文件传输
  • 如何进行Linux与windows文件传输
    这期内容当中小编将会给大家带来有关如何进行Linux与windows文件传输,文章内容丰富且以专业的角度为大家分析和叙述,阅读完这篇文章希望大家可以有所收获。Linux系统之间传输文件有很多种方法,此篇博客介绍其中的两种。也是在开发过程中经...
    99+
    2023-06-05
  • Python怎么使用Netmiko进行文件传输
    传输配置文件、映像文件等是网络设备管理中常见的操作。Netmiko是一个Python库,可用于与各种网络设备进行交互,提供了一些用于传输文件的函数,其中包括SCP(Secure Copy Protocol)函数。Netmiko简介Netmi...
    99+
    2023-05-19
    Python netmiko
  • 如何利用java-RMI进行大文件传输
    今天就跟大家聊聊有关如何利用java-RMI进行大文件传输,可能很多人都不太了解,为了让大家更加了解,小编给大家总结了以下内容,希望大家根据这篇文章可以有所收获。为什么要用RMI在这次的项目中,对于客户端与服务器之间的通信,想了许多办法,由...
    99+
    2023-06-17
  • 如何在java中使用socket对zip文件进行传输
    今天就跟大家聊聊有关如何在java中使用socket对zip文件进行传输,可能很多人都不太了解,为了让大家更加了解,小编给大家总结了以下内容,希望大家根据这篇文章可以有所收获。服务器端程序:import java.io.*;import j...
    99+
    2023-05-31
    java socket zip文件
  • scp命令进行文件传输
    scp命令进行文件传输 一、登录目标服务器二、将本地服务器文件上传到目标服务器三、将目标服务器文件下载到本地服务器 ...
    99+
    2023-10-05
    服务器 linux ssh
  • 教你在Linux SysOps中使用SSH进行文件传输
    在Linux SysOps中,使用SSH进行文件传输是非常常见的操作。SSH(Secure Shell)是一种安全的网络通信协议,可...
    99+
    2023-10-09
    Linux
  • 如何用Volume在主机和Docker间进行文件传输
    本文小编为大家详细介绍“如何用Volume在主机和Docker间进行文件传输”,内容详细,步骤清晰,细节处理妥当,希望这篇“如何用Volume在主机和Docker间进行文件传输”文章能帮助大家解决疑惑,下面...
    99+
    2022-10-19
  • win8远程桌面连接传输文件(与本地磁盘进行文件传输)
      win7和win8中链接远程桌面相信大家都会用,但是你知道如何在用远程桌面与本地磁盘进行文件传输吗   其实很简单,win7中:启动远程桌面: 开始—程序—附件—远程...
    99+
    2022-06-04
    磁盘 与本 文件传输
  • 详解Android使用Socket对大文件进行加密传输
    前言数据加密,是一门历史悠久的技术,指通过加密算法和加密密钥将明文转变为密文,而解密则是通过解密算法和解密密钥将密文恢复为明文。它的核心是密码学。数据加密目前仍是计算机系统对信息进行保护的一种最可靠的办法。它利用密码技术对信息进行加密,实现...
    99+
    2023-05-31
    android 文件加密 对大
  • Linux中怎么使用ftp命令对文件进行传输
    本篇文章为大家展示了Linux中怎么使用ftp命令对文件进行传输,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。  [root@www ~]# yum install ftp 安装ftp支持 RedH...
    99+
    2023-06-13
  • 两台Linux系统该如何怎样进行文件传输
    这篇文章跟大家分析一下“两台Linux系统该如何怎样进行文件传输”。内容详细易懂,对“两台Linux系统该如何怎样进行文件传输”感兴趣的朋友可以跟着小编的思路慢慢深入来阅读一下,希望阅读后能够对大家有所帮助。下面跟着小编一起深入学习“两台L...
    99+
    2023-06-28
  • 利用java 怎么在局域网中进行文件传输
    利用java 怎么在局域网中进行文件传输?相信很多没有经验的人对此束手无策,为此本文总结了问题出现的原因和解决方法,通过这篇文章希望你能解决这个问题。java 实现局域网文件传输ClientFile.java package&nb...
    99+
    2023-05-31
    java 局域网 ava
  • 如何使用安全的文件传输协议(SFTP)保护CentOS服务器上的文件传输
    要在CentOS服务器上使用安全的文件传输协议(SFTP)来保护文件传输,需要执行以下步骤:1. 安装OpenSSH服务器:```s...
    99+
    2023-10-09
    CentOS
  • 还在使用文件传输协议传输机密文件?你可能是对文件传输协议有什么误会
    文件传输协议(FTP)为用户提供了一种从一个位置临时向另一个位置发送文件和信息的简单方法。FTP提供了一种在计算机(或服务器)之间建立通信以进行文件传输的介质。尽管它仍然是一种广泛使用且被大众熟知的文件传输方法,但人们对FTP有诸多误解,以...
    99+
    2023-06-03
  • 在Java中使用SFTP传输文件
    1. 概述 在本教程中,我们将讨论如何在Java中使用SFTP从远程服务器上传和下载文件。 我们将使用三个不同的库:JSch、SSHJ 和 Apache Commons VFS来实现。 2. 使用 JSch 首先,让我们看看如何使用JSch...
    99+
    2023-08-25
    java 服务器 apache
  • vps之间如何传输文件
    VPS之间可以通过多种方式传输文件,以下是其中几种常见的方法:1. SCP(Secure Copy):SCP是基于SSH协议的一种安...
    99+
    2023-09-08
    vps
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作